Output c8586dfdcac208f161f24c5fa5de14e758d34302fc4a9c64ec85194115b0b07a:22

value
3961945
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ab23507516a65ab35639ddf0e409c7476d37ddb OP_EQUALVERIFY OP_CHECKSIG
address
1DeMjXGsZbbSh12YL1iWjqy33cryJf2GwA
transaction
c8586dfdcac208f161f24c5fa5de14e758d34302fc4a9c64ec85194115b0b07a
spent
true